The Story of Katherin

Katherin first appeared in U.S. Social Security Administration records as a baby girl name in 1892, with 5 babies given the name that year. Its peak popularity came in 1989, when 277 Katherins were born — ranking #717 that year. As of 2026, Katherin ranks #4,038 for baby girls with 36 births, holding steady (-5%). In total, more than 4K Katherins have been born in the U.S. since records began in 1880, spanning the 1890s through the 2020s.
